Background
Water quality monitoring is the prerequisite of guaranteeing safe water use, and the quality of drinking water is direct to be concerned with people's health, therefore must all examine strictly in every production link of domestic water, need treat the water that detects before the water quality testing and take a sample, and the current sampler has basically satisfied water quality testing's user demand, still has some weak points and needs the improvement.
When the sampler is used for acquiring a water sample, the sampler usually can acquire the sample at one position of a sampling place, the water samples acquired at different positions can have difference and need to be stored separately, and a part of water quality detection sampler does not have a structure convenient for separate sampling and storage, in addition, water at different depths also has sample difference, the water in deeper depths is often needed to be sampled during sampling, and a part of water quality detection sampler does not have a structure convenient for acquiring the deep water sample, so that a water quality detection sampler is needed to solve the problems.

Preferably, the side wall of the storage box is provided with a drain pipe, and the lower end of the drain pipe is in threaded connection with a screw cap.
Preferably, the limiting mechanism comprises a spring sleeved outside the water inlet pipe, the lower end of the spring is fixedly connected with the storage box, the upper end of the spring is fixedly connected with a sliding sleeve, and the sliding sleeve is connected with the water inlet pipe in a sliding manner.
Preferably, the sample separating pipe is sleeved with a fixing piece, and the upper end of the fixing piece is fixedly connected with the sampling box.
Preferably, the sampling box lateral wall is equipped with the recess with lantern ring assorted, the lantern ring rotates with the recess to be connected.
Preferably, one end of the telescopic pipe, which is far away from the soft water pipe, is fixedly connected with a filter cylinder.

Drawings
Fig. 1 is a schematic front view of a cross-sectional structure of the present invention;
fig. 2 is a schematic top view of the cross-sectional structure of the present invention.
In the figure: 1. a base; 2. a storage box; 3. a water inlet pipe; 4. a sample distributing pipe; 5. a sampling box; 6. a collar; 7. a support; 8. a water pump; 9. a flexible water pipe; 10. a telescopic pipe; 11. screwing a cover; 12. a spring; 13. a sliding sleeve; 14. a stabilizing member; 15. a groove; 16. a filter cartridge; 17. and a water discharge pipe.
